    Abstract: An intermediary system is disposed along a communication path between a user device, such as a Web-enabled mobile phone, and a content server. The user device sends a request, such as an HTTP GET request, for a data page at the content server. The data page may be, for example, the hypertext markup language (HTML) code of a Web page. The intermediary receives the request and determines whether the requested data page includes a data reference, such as a uniform resource locator (URL) of an embedded image in the Web page. If the requested page includes a data reference, the intermediary creates a preload instruction and sends the preload instruction to the user device in a response to the request for the data page. The preload instruction instructs the user device to load the referenced data. The preload instruction may be a hidden frame.

    Abstract: A dynamic content routing network routes update messages containing updates to properties of live objects from input sources to clients. The clients receive a web page having live objects, identify the object IDs associated with the objects, and contact an object state storage to obtain update messages specifying the objects' initial properties. The clients register the object IDs with the routing network. The routing network maintains a registry of object IDs and clients. The input source provides an update messages to the routing network containing the object ID and data for updating a property of the object. The routing network routes update messages from the input source to the clients registered for the object ID contained in the message. Upon receipt of the message, a client updates the specified property of the live object. The update messages are also provided to, and stored by, the object state storage.

    Abstract: The present invention is an apparatus and method for constructing a Constraint-Choice-Action Matrix for making decisions based on constraints. Columns (in one matrix orientation) state conditions. The column header presents a partial boolean expression. Such variable expression may be any object or type, e.g., a number, string, or list. An entry in a cell, selected using a GUI pick-list, combines with the column header, to complete the boolean expression. The set of boolean expressions in a row may be combined into an action boolean statement. If that statement evaluates to true, some action, represented as a row header, is recommended or executed. The matrix is applied to an instance of a context domain, for decision-making. The context domain may be represented in a model representing an instance of that domain (e.g., a product specification for configuration of a machine) in data and rules.

    Abstract: A system and method for controlling the presentation of words on an electronic reading device to assist in speed reading. A portion of the display screen on the device is reserved for the serial presentation of the words in accordance with the speed reading method. The remainder of the screen contains the current text of the content being read, but is shaded, darkened, so as to not distract the reader. The presentation of words is momentarily paused at sentence and chapter transitions. This momentary pause allows the user to maintain perspective as to the user's location in an electronic text (e.g., a book) and enhances the reading experience and ultimately enhances the speed of the reading exercise and the retention of content.
